1、 Introduction to Antibacterial Silicone Rubber
Silicone rubber is a rubber material made mainly from silicon, which has the advantages of temperature resistance, chemical resistance, and good flexibility. It is widely used in various fields such as automobiles, electronics, medical equipment, and daily necessities. Antibacterial silicone rubber refers to a silicone rubber material with antibacterial functions. Antibacterial silicone rubber has a killing and inhibitory effect on harmful micro production such as bacteria and mold. It is achieved by adding silicone rubber antibacterial agents, such as silver ion antibacterial agents, to the material. After being combined with silicone rubber, it continuously releases silver ions during use, which can damage and inhibit the cell membrane structure and metabolic enzymes of microorganisms, Change the growth environment of microorganisms and have an impact on cell membranes, thereby delaying the growth rate and quantity of bacteria, and extending the service life of silicone rubber. In medical or daily use of silicone rubber products, the proliferation of microorganisms is associated with various infectious bacteria, such as sepsis related to catheters, mucosal infections, and athlete skin infections. Antibacterial silicone rubber products can prevent infections caused by bacteria.

2、 Selection and usage of silicone rubber antibacterial agents
The selection of silicone rubber antibacterial agents should be based on the usage environment of silicone rubber and the performance requirements of the end product. If silicone rubber is used in humid environments or frequently comes into contact with water, it needs to have inhibitory effects on both bacteria and mold. Therefore, it is necessary to choose anti mold antibacterial agents, such as some organic antibacterial agents ZPT or organic inorganic composite antibacterial agents. If applied in some dry environments, such as medical equipment, mainly to resist bacteria and prevent bacterial infections from spreading to you, choose antibacterial agents, such as silver ion antibacterial agents.

Antibacterial silicone rubber is generally mixed using a two-stage method. The first stage is to first put the raw rubber, antibacterial agent, and other additives except for accelerator and sulfur into an internal mixer for mixing, with a discharge temperature between 135 ℃ and 140 ℃. Mix and park for 48 hours, then add accelerator and sulfur to the torch opening machine for the second stage of mixing, and finally shape the mixed adhesive onto the mold.
